How to Become a Advertising Sales Agents in Indiana

Advertising Sales Agents in Indiana earn a median salary of $57,030/year, which is 12% below the national average. Indiana has a state income tax of ~3.0%. After taxes and rent, a advertising sales agents takes home approximately $2,485/month. Most positions require High school diploma or equivalent.

Advertising Sales Agents salary by metro area in Indiana

Metro areaMedianHourlyEmployment
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ood$60K$29.02/hr550
Fort Wayne$58K$27.92/hr140
South Bend-Mishawaka$57K$27.33/hr60
Bloomington$53K$25.46/hr60
Evansville$50K$24.13/hr70

How much does a advertising sales agents make in Indiana?

The median advertising sales agents salary in Indiana is $57,030 per year ($27.42/hr). This is 12% below the national median of $64,820. Salaries range from $28,450 to $103,870.

What are the requirements to become a advertising sales agents in Indiana?

Advertising Sales Agents positions in Indiana typically require High school diploma or equivalent. Indiana may have specific licensing or certification requirements. Check with the Indiana licensing board or department of labor for current requirements.

Can a advertising sales agents afford to live in Indiana?

At the median salary of $57,030, a advertising sales agents in Indiana would take home approximately $3,844/month after taxes. With median 2-bedroom rent at $1,359/month, that's 35.4% of take-home pay going to housing. This exceeds the recommended 30% guideline.

What are the best cities for advertising sales agents in Indiana?

The highest paying metro areas for advertising sales agents in Indiana are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ood ($60,350), Fort Wayne ($58,070), South Bend-Mishawaka ($56,850). However, cost of living varies significantly between metros, a higher salary may not mean more purchasing power.
